I tracked my car from Barcelona on marinetraffic.com but had to do some detective work first. I seem to remember having to look at port of tyne's website to see what was docking when and that gave the departing port of the ships. That gave me the name of the ship which I then searched on marine traffic. It only took a couple of days to get from Barcelona to Tyne so you may be too late but it's worth a look. Good luck!
